Pressure-Reducing Valves: A Comprehensive Guide
Pressure-reducing regulators are critical components in fluid systems, designed to safely lower high inlet head to a lower outlet force. Said devices shield equipment and systems from harm caused by over- pressure, while also providing a steady downstream force.
Considerations when choosing a pressure-reducing device include the inlet head range, outlet head requirement, flow capacity, and the kind of substance being handled. Here's a quick look:
- Types: Direct-acting, Pilot-operated
- Materials: Stainless steel, Brass, Bronze
- Applications: Residential water systems, Industrial processes, Irrigation
Proper setup and servicing are key to maximum performance and lifespan of these regulators .

Water Pressure Regulator Problems & Solutions
Dealing with fluctuating home force can be a significant headache, and often the cause is a malfunctioning pressure regulator. These devices are designed to maintain a consistent level of pressure, protecting your fixtures from damage, but they can experience issues. Common problems include excessively high pressure , low intensity, drips , or complete stoppage. Possible remedies range from simple adjustments – often requiring a specific wrench to modify the regulator's dial – to substituting the entire unit. Sometimes, sediment deposit inside the regulator can hinder operation; cleaning the regulator might resolve this. If these steps don't succeed the concern, it's best to consult a licensed professional to diagnose and address the difficulty.
- Inspect for obvious leaks .
- Check the force gauge reading.
- Attempt a regulator tweak .
- Consider professional support.
